i have an asrock z390 phantom gaming 4 motherboard. i need to add a toslink output so i bought a cheap solution on amazon. i need to figure out where and if my motherboard has a spdif connection. any help is appreciated

Z390 Phantom Gaming 4 didn't support Optical SPDIF output.
